How do I add presets to my Fender Mustang?
- Open the navigation menu and select Download.
- Use the search bar or filter to find the preset you want to download.
- Tap on the preset to get more details, and tap Add when you’re ready to download.
- Any presets you download are added to your amp and displayed in the My Presets section of the app.

What amp settings did Kurt Cobain use?
Kurt Cobain used a range of tones depending on the songs he was playing, but generally, he set his amp settings at 7-8 for the treble and mids and the bass around 5. He generally set his distortion high for choruses (8-10) unless a pedal was used.
What amp did Kurt Cobain use?
Kurt’s amplifier of choice for live performance was a combination of the Mesa Boogie Studio . 22 acting as a preamp and a Crest 4801 as his power amp. The first iteration of this setup was the Mesa Boogie paired with Crown Power Base 2 800w Power Amp, but Kurt felt the Crest worked better with the Mesa preamp.

How do you reset a 1 amp Mustang?
Press and hold the EXIT button while turning the amplifier ON. Continue holding the EXIT button until it is no longer illuminated. The FACTORY RESTORE function will erase all user modified presets.

Is Mustang better than Stratocaster?
The Quick Answer. Stratocasters differ from Mustangs primarily due to their extra single coil pickup, more regular shaped body and longer scale length. Mustangs tend to sound a bit warmer than Stratocasters which sound quite bright. Both models have 22 frets, single coil pickups and a similar C-shape neck.

What amp does Joe Bonamassa use?
Amp-wise, Bonamassa’s rig features a pair of vintage Marshall heads – an ’86 50-watt JCM800 and an ’87 100-watt Silver Jubilee. “These amps stay on the entire time,” he explains. “That is basically the anchor sound.” He goes on to describe how he usually has four amps running in tandem at a time.
